Virginia HB 84 (2022) — Out-of-state audiologists; providing free health care to an underserved area in the Commonwealth.

Volunteer audiologists. Permits out-of-stateaudiologists to volunteer to provide free health care to an underservedarea of the Commonwealth under the auspices of a publicly supportednonprofit organization that sponsors the provision of health careto populations of underserved people if they do so for a period notexceeding three consecutive days and if the nonprofit organizationverifies that the practitioner has a valid, unrestricted license inanother state.

Timeline

The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.

  • 2022-01-05 Prefiled and ordered printed; offered 01/12/22 22102057D introduction
  • 2022-01-05 Referred to Committee on Health, Welfare and Institutions referral-committee
  • 2022-01-11 Impact statement from DPB (HB84)
  • 2022-01-20 Reported from Health, Welfare and Institutions (21-Y 0-N) committee-passage
  • 2022-01-24 Read first time reading-1
  • 2022-01-25 Read second time and engrossed reading-2
  • 2022-01-26 Read third time and passed House BLOCK VOTE (97-Y 0-N) passage, reading-3
  • 2022-01-26 VOTE: Block Vote Passage (97-Y 0-N)
  • 2022-01-27 Constitutional reading dispensed
  • 2022-01-27 Referred to Committee on Education and Health referral-committee
  • 2022-02-16 Assigned Education sub: Health Professions referral-committee
  • 2022-02-24 Reported from Education and Health (15-Y 0-N) committee-passage
  • 2022-02-25 Constitutional reading dispensed (39-Y 0-N)
  • 2022-02-28 Read third time reading-3
  • 2022-02-28 Passed Senate (40-Y 0-N) passage
  • 2022-03-02 Enrolled
  • 2022-03-02 Signed by Speaker
  • 2022-03-03 Impact statement from DPB (HB84ER)
  • 2022-03-03 Signed by President
  • 2022-03-11 Enrolled Bill communicated to Governor on March 11, 2022
  • 2022-03-11 Governor's Action Deadline 11:59 p.m., April 11, 2022
  • 2022-04-07 Approved by Governor-Chapter 173 (effective 7/1/22) executive-signature
